(1) Policy. The performance evaluation process is intended to improve productivity through systematic communication between supervisors and employees regarding performance standards, goals, employee concerns, problems, training needs and opportunities.

(2) Rules.

(a) Each elected official and department head shall develop and maintain performance evaluation systems for all groups of employees.

(b) The performance evaluation systems shall be based on standards related to an employee’s work assignment.

(c) The performance evaluation systems shall provide the employee with an opportunity to submit a written response to the contents of his/her evaluation. The contents of an employee’s evaluation are not subject to the grievance procedure. (Added by Ord. 84-129 § 2, Nov. 21, 1984; Amended by Ord. 04-141, Jan. 19, 2005, Eff date Jan. 31, 2005).
